Kevin Dabbs Obituary

Kevin Dabbs

June 7, 1959 - Sept. 30, 2023

MADISON - Kevin Dabbs, age 64, of Madison Wis., passed away on Saturday, Sept. 30, 2023, at his home. He was born on June 7, 1959, in Tulare, Calif., the son of Glen Dabbs and Charline (Sparks) Higgins.

Kevin, age 15, and Nancy (Denney) Dabbs, age 13, met while Kevin was walking his dog down the street. The two remained inseparable and were married on Aug. 15, 1981, in Tulare, Calif. Their love was a testament to the enduring power of commitment and partnership. Their bond will be remembered as a shining example of love's strength.

Kevin began his career in epilepsy and neuroimaging in the Department of Neurology at the University of Wisconsin School of Medicine and Public Health in 2004. Kevin became an integral part of the UW Epilepsy Research group collaborating with researchers in neuropsychology, neurology, and radiology. Kevin was noted for his attention to detail and integrity. As a researcher, Kevin was well respected and admired. Even more importantly, Kevin was noted to be trustworthy, kind, and generous. Kevin was always telling stories about his family revealing his love for wife, sons and grandchildren. Kevin was always open to have a good laugh and always enjoyed life. His warmth and kindness will be greatly missed.

Kevin loved spending time with his nine grandchildren and had a special bond with each one. He enjoyed riding his motorcycle and had a love of music. He was very handy with about anything and everything whether it was at home or work. Kevin also loved working in the yard, sci-fi movies, and astronomy. Kevin always looked forward to driving around in his pick-up truck with his German Shepard, Reagan, riding in the back.

Kevin is survived by his wife, Nancy; three sons, Kyle (Amber) Dabbs, and their children Kaden (16), Konner (10), Korbin (9); Derek (Kristina) Dabbs, and their children, Kemma (7), Dax (4), Dawson (2); and Dylan (Felicia) Dabbs and their children, Alexander (11), Dayton (8) Kassadi (1); sister, Tina Dabbs; mother-in-law, Margie Denney; several nieces, nephews, as well as other relatives and friends. He was preceded in death by his parents; and father-in-law, Claude Denney, Jr.
